Celigo is a leading provider of Integration Platform as a Service (iPaaS), providing the highest levels of support and service to our customers. The SaaS industry is growing rapidly and so are we. To keep up with industry demands, we are hiring a NetSuite Alliances Manager to manage the day-to-day partnership operations.
The NetSuite Alliance Manager works closely across the entire organization including Product, Finance, Sales, Channel, Marketing, and Engineering to meet departmental goals. The ideal candidate thrives in a fast-paced environment, has a professional in-service-to attitude in writing and on the phone, takes initiative, and is passionate about cloud-based technology. This position can grow into running one of the key Alliance Partner Programs.
What you’d do, if hired:
• Manage and expand existing relationship with NetSuite
• Identify opportunities to create new programs with NetSuite sales reps and partners
• Respond to a high volume of inbound questions from partner (NetSuite) sales reps, ensuring they receive accurate and timely responses.
• Manage high-volume sales programs
• Prepare reports for both internal and external teams on a monthly and quarterly basis
• Represent Celigo at networking events, seminars and trade shows.
• Conduct sales presentations online to communicate the value of Celigo’s solutions.
• Tracking leads and opportunities in Salesforce: add and update contact and account information, prepare and generate quotes and agreements, manage opportunity pipeline, and keep lead/opportunity details and communications up to date.
• Work with Celigo Marketing on product reviews and customer references.
• Assist in the creation of sales materials and pitch decks.
• Attend sales and product training and meetings.
• Ensuring that external marketplace listings are up-to-date
• Manage escalations in a calm and professional manner
